+# Function to show recommended UCX settings for RDMA
+show_rdma_settings() {
+ print_section "Recommended UCX Settings for RDMA"
+
+ print_info "For optimal RDMA performance with SeaweedFS:"
+ echo ""
+ echo "Environment Variables:"
+ echo " export UCX_TLS=rc_verbs,ud_verbs,rc_mlx5_dv,dc_mlx5_dv"
+ echo " export UCX_NET_DEVICES=all"
+ echo " export UCX_LOG_LEVEL=info"
+ echo " export UCX_RNDV_SCHEME=put_zcopy"
+ echo " export UCX_RNDV_THRESH=8192"
+ echo ""
+
+ print_info "For development/debugging:"
+ echo " export UCX_LOG_LEVEL=debug"
+ echo " export UCX_LOG_FILE=/tmp/ucx.log"
+ echo ""
+
+ print_info "For Soft-RoCE (RXE) specifically:"
+ echo " export UCX_TLS=rc_verbs,ud_verbs"
+ echo " export UCX_IB_DEVICE_SPECS=rxe0:1"
+ echo ""
+}
